Standard or Double Bubble ?!?!?
#1
Morning all,

Im looking to change my screen to a dark tint (Black).

Im unsure on whether to go with the Standard or Double Bubble.
How many people are running the Double Bubble? Are the wind resistant advantages noticable?

I have a double bubble on my 09 busa and also had one on my 99 busa as well, if you are around the 5 ten mark in height you will appreciate the double bubble especiaaly as the speeds get up.

#5
If you go the double make sure you don't get one that refracts the sun causing it to melt your dash. I'm not sure if it was on this site that I saw pictures of this & I think it may only be the cheap Chinese variants that do this!!!!

#13
(26-09-2011, 12:29pm)pan Wrote: Do the double! Helps you see your gauges when sitting upright.
There was a recent thread on this...

without the double bubble you wont see the turn indicators.
With a double bubble you will have (slightly) less chance of leaving the indicators on! Lol3

Mine melted the dash, but with a tinted one you shouldn't have a problem. I now the busa club sticker on the front to stop the hotspot. They are heaps better. At 6'4" you really do need one.
